Step-by-Step Guide to Resetting Your Garage Door Opener
Resetting your garage door opener successfully can differ by model and model, however typically, the method can be broken down into a quantity of essential steps:
1. Locate the Reset Button
The reset button is usually found on the garage door opener's motor unit. In Los Angeles houses, this is usually located near the ceiling. It could be a small purple or yellow button.
2. Press and Hold the Reset Button
Pressing and holding the reset button will initiate the reset course of. Keep in mind, the motor unit will usually provide you with a signal, such as a beep or mild flash, indicating that the resetting is in progress.
3. Reprogram Remotes and Keypads
After the opener has been reset, you will need to reprogram any remotes and keypads associated along with your garage door. Detailed instructions for particular brands could be found in the user guide, typically situated within the Encino space's service centers.
4. Test the System
Once every thing is reprogrammed, test your garage door opener to make sure it operates smoothly. Consider performing operations from various distances to confirm the remote’s connectivity.

Maintaining Your Garage Door Opener
Regular maintenance can prevent the necessity for extreme resets and ensure that your garage door opener performs optimally:
- Lubricate transferring elements annually. Inspect cables and hardware for wear and tear. Keep the sensor space clean to avoid disruptions.
